Active terahertz modulator based on optically controlled organometal halide perovskite MAPbI2Br.

Published in 2022 at "Applied optics"

DOI: 10.1364/ao.444667

Abstract: In this paper, an active terahertz modulator based on optically controlled organometal halide perovskite MAPbI2Br is proposed. The terahertz wave time-domain transmission of the MAPbI2Br/Al2O3 sample was measured by a terahertz time-domain spectrometer. Experimental results… read more here.
